The cost of installing double-glazed windows will vary depending on the size of your home. For larger houses, you will need to pay more. You can still get the best price by selecting local installers. They know the area and will offer more personal service. Costs also depend on the material that is used to build the windows. There are uPVC and aluminium framed options. window replacement birmingham -framed windows are slimmer and more efficient in terms of thermal efficiency. A wooden frame is another option for a classic look. Timber frames are more costly and require more care. The amount of windows and doors you have in your home will determine the cost of installation. Sliding and tilt and turn windows are a great alternative for those who want to be more flexible. The color you choose for double-glazed windows can be a personal preference. No matter what color you pick it is essential to have a contingency plan. The fund will pay for any unexpected costs. The type of material used will impact the cost of double-glazed windows. The average cost of installing a sash window is between PS500 and PS900. A casement window can cost anywhere from PS250 to PS400. You'll need to take into consideration the size of your property when determining the cost of double glazing windows in Birmingham. You can expect to pay between PS14,000 and PS32,000 to buy larger houses, while a smaller three-bedroom semi-detached could be fitted for just PS3000.
